Executive Certificate in Sensor Integration for Self-Driving Cars: UK Career Outlook
The UK's autonomous vehicle sector is booming, creating exciting opportunities for professionals with expertise in sensor integration. This certificate positions you at the forefront of this transformative industry.
| Career Role |
Description |
| Autonomous Vehicle Sensor Integration Engineer (Sensor Integration, Self-Driving Cars) |
Design, develop, and integrate sensor systems (LiDAR, radar, cameras) for self-driving cars, ensuring seamless data fusion and reliable performance. |
| Senior Perception Engineer (Self-Driving Cars) (Sensor Fusion, AI, Machine Learning) |
Develop advanced algorithms for sensor data processing, object detection, and scene understanding, enabling autonomous navigation. |
| Robotics Software Engineer (Autonomous Driving) (Sensor Data Processing, Software Development) |
Develop and maintain software for autonomous vehicle systems, integrating sensor data with control algorithms for precise vehicle maneuvers. |
| AI/ML Specialist (Autonomous Systems) (Machine Learning, Artificial Intelligence, Sensor Calibration) |
Develop and implement machine learning models for sensor data analysis, improving the accuracy and reliability of autonomous driving systems. |

Why this course?
An Executive Certificate in Sensor Integration for Self-Driving Cars is increasingly significant in the UK's rapidly evolving automotive technology sector. The UK government aims to have fully autonomous vehicles on the roads by 2025, driving substantial demand for skilled professionals in sensor fusion and data processing. According to recent studies, the UK autonomous vehicle market is projected to reach £42 billion by 2035. This growth necessitates expertise in integrating diverse sensor modalities – LiDAR, radar, cameras – for robust and reliable self-driving systems. This certificate program directly addresses this industry need, equipping professionals with the advanced knowledge required for system design, testing, and validation. Graduates are well-positioned for roles in autonomous vehicle development, sensor technology companies, and related research institutions.
